Agnes grey, a novel is the debut novel of english author anne bronte writing under the pen name of acton bell, first published in december 1847, and republished in a second edition in 1850.

Agnes grey looks at childhood from nursery to adolescence, and it also charts the frustrations of romantic love, as agnes starts to nurse warmer feelings towards the local curate, mr weston. The novel combines astute dissection of middleclass social behaviour and class attitudes with a wonderful study of victorian responses to young children. Drawn from anne brontes own experiences, agnes grey depicts the harsh conditions and class snobbery that governesses were often forced to endure. Agnes grey is an autobiographical novel which recounts the experience of a young governess born of a financiallyruined clergyman.
